Property tax in Vaucourtois

34.52%

municipal rate on buildings, set in 2025 · unchanged since 2023

Median for towns of its size band: 34.53%.

In 2024, Vaucourtois collected 97 k€ in property and residence taxes, or 33% of its revenue.
